How does the absorption of iron from plant foods differ from animal foods?

The absorption of iron from plant foods differs from that from animal foods primarily due to the type of iron present. Animal sources contain heme iron, which is more readily absorbed by the body, while plant sources provide non-heme iron, which has lower bioavailability. Additionally, plant foods often contain compounds like phytates and polyphenols that can inhibit iron absorption. To enhance non-heme iron absorption, it is beneficial to consume vitamin C-rich foods alongside plant-based iron sources.

Do all protein foods contain iron?

Not all protein foods contain iron. While animal-based protein sources, such as red meat, poultry, and fish, are typically rich in heme iron, many plant-based proteins, like legumes, nuts, and seeds, contain non-heme iron, which is less readily absorbed by the body. However, some plant-based foods, like tofu and quinoa, also provide iron. It's important to include a variety of protein sources in your diet to meet your iron needs.
